Autoradiographic localization of sigma receptor binding sites in guinea pig and rat central nervous system with ( )3H-3-(3-hydroxyphenyl)-N-(1-propyl)piperidine
AL Gundlach, BL Largent, SH Snyder
Journal of Neuroscience | SOC NEUROSCIENCE | Published : 1986
Abstract
(+)3H-3-PPP [(+)3H-3-(3-Hydroxyphenyl)-N-(1-propyl)-piperidine] binds with high affinity to brain membranes with a pharmacological profile consistent with that of sigma receptors. The distribution of (+)3H-3-PPP binding sites in brain and spinal cord of both guinea pig and rat has been determined by in vitro autoradiography with binding densities quantitated by computer-assisted densitometry. (+)3H-3-PPP binding to slide-mounted brain sections is saturable and displays high affinity and a pharmacological specificity very similar to sites labeled in homogenates.
